Archives hub
The Archives hub provides a single point of access to more than 19,000 descriptions of archives collections held in more than 150 UK universities and colleges. Complete catalogue descriptions are provided where they are available. The Archives hub forms one part of the UK's National Archives Network, alongside related networking projects. The service is hosted at MIMAS on behalf of RLUK (Research Libraries UK) - formerly CURL, the Consortium of University Research Libraries - and is funded by the Joint Information Systems Committee (JISC). Systems development work is undertaken at the University of Liverpool.
